Shelby was born in Conecuh County, Alabama on February 9, 1955 to the late Raymond and Flora Stallworth. She departed this life peacefully on August 2, 2023. She was also preceded in death by grandchildren, Rayvion Ward and Ivy Meeks.
She grew up a military brat, traveling abroad, but always returned home to Alabama. On June 23, 1974, she married James Meeks and from this union, their six children were born.
Shelby dedicated her time to her community and serving on several auxiliaries of First Missionary Baptist Church. Being known as a fun-loving person, she never met a stranger. She served as an Educational Assistant at Kreole Elementary, Montessori Learning Center and Merry-Go-Round before furthering her education at Gulf Coast Community College and University of Southern Mississippi.
She leaves to cherish her memories three daughters Fatima (Reginald), Takisha and Vashti; three sons, Marlon, Jereme and Quincey; seven grandchildren, Keturah, Reginald Jr., Raylon, Jamarcus, Braxton, Shelby and Marlon, Jr. and a host of family and friends.
